Workers get an early jump on census

It’s not yet 2020, but preparations are underway for the 2020 Census.

Some workers are canvassing neighborhoods, in the Inland Empire and nationwide, checking addresses for next year’s count, according to a statement posted on San Bernardino County’s website.

The census, conducted every 10 years, is important to cities and counties because it helps determine funding for improvement projects. All Inland residents are asked to cooperate with anyone who presents a Census I.D. and wants to ask them questions.

The San Bernardino County and Riverside County boards of supervisors have formed the Inland Empire Complete Count Committee, which will work with the public and private sector to ensure as accurate a local count as possible, according to the statement.
